KOMSENS-6G is part of a broader German 6G initiative and has € 14.9 million in funding , over three years . Networking with other projects and partners of the overall national initiative takes place via the central ‘ 6G Platform Germany ’.
In the 6G era , sensing will be a key enabling technology towards the vision of bringing together the digital and physical worlds . The sensing service will be fully integrated into the wireless network for simultaneous operation with communication services . Nokia will play a leading role in researching technology solutions for front-end , baseband , RAN protocols , data processing and security to make the 6G vision a reality .

Telefónica Tech and Qualys sign alliance for Iberian market
Telefónica Tech , and Qualys , a provider of cloud-based security and compliance solutions , have signed a cybersecurity agreement to integrate the native Qualys Cloud Platform and its cloud applications into Telefónica Tech ’ s portfolio of managed security services for Spain and Portugal .
This alliance provides cutting-edge technology for the team of security professionals by offering 360-degree visibility into on-premises , desktop , cloud , container or mobile environments and enabling , from a single cloud platform , the assessment of critical security intelligence , as well as automating the full spectrum of auditing , compliance and protection of IT systems and web applications .
“ This agreement with Qualys will allow us to complement and enhance our positioning in the cybersecurity field with an innovative technology that enables a unique and integrated approach , providing a continuous protection cycle ,” said Alberto Sempere , Cybersecurity Product Director at Telefónica Tech . “ This will enable Telefónica Tech ’ s SOCs to address the high complexity of our customers ’ hybrid and multi-network environments with a more agile , comprehensive and effective security posture thanks to Qualys ’ technology .”
“ We are very pleased to be a trusted partner of Telefónica Tech and to be able to bring our technology to all its customers in the Iberian market ,” said Sergio Pedroche , Country Manager for Spain and Portugal at Qualys .
